|
Maps SDK for C++ 1.0.0
|
This is the complete list of members for gem::SdkSettings, including all inherited members.
| getActualTheme() const noexcept | gem::SdkSettings | inline |
| getAllowConnection() const noexcept | gem::SdkSettings | inline |
| getAllowOffboardServiceOnExtraChargedNetwork(EServiceGroupType serviceType) const noexcept | gem::SdkSettings | inline |
| getAppAuthorization() const noexcept | gem::SdkSettings | inline |
| getApplicationName() const noexcept | gem::SdkSettings | inline |
| getApplicationVersion() const noexcept | gem::SdkSettings | inline |
| getBestLanguageMatch(const String &languageCode, const String ®ionCode=String(), const String &scriptCode=String(), int variant=0) const noexcept | gem::SdkSettings | inline |
| getBestVoiceMatch(const String &languageCode, const String ®ionCode) const noexcept | gem::SdkSettings | inline |
| getDecimalSeparator() const noexcept | gem::SdkSettings | inline |
| getDeviceModel() const noexcept | gem::SdkSettings | inline |
| getDeviceName() const noexcept | gem::SdkSettings | inline |
| getDigitGroupSeparator() const noexcept | gem::SdkSettings | inline |
| getLanguage() const noexcept | gem::SdkSettings | inline |
| getLanguageList() const noexcept | gem::SdkSettings | inline |
| getMapLanguage() const noexcept | gem::SdkSettings | inline |
| getNetworkProvider() noexcept | gem::SdkSettings | inline |
| getOnlineServiceRestriction(EServiceGroupType svc) const noexcept | gem::SdkSettings | inline |
| getStripeDonateSession(String &session, double amount, const String ¤cy, ProgressListener listener, bool dryRun=false) const noexcept | gem::SdkSettings | inline |
| getStripePublicKey(String &session, ProgressListener listener, bool dryRun=false) const noexcept | gem::SdkSettings | inline |
| getTheme() const noexcept | gem::SdkSettings | inline |
| getTilesMaxSpace() const noexcept | gem::SdkSettings | inline |
| getTopicNotificationsServiceRestriction() const noexcept | gem::SdkSettings | inline |
| getTransferStatistics(EServiceGroupType serviceType) | gem::SdkSettings | inline |
| getUnitSystem() const noexcept | gem::SdkSettings | inline |
| getVoice() const noexcept | gem::SdkSettings | inline |
| operator=(const SdkSettings &)=delete (defined in gem::SdkSettings) | gem::SdkSettings | |
| operator=(SdkSettings &&sdksettings)=default | gem::SdkSettings | |
| SdkSettings()=default (defined in gem::SdkSettings) | gem::SdkSettings | |
| SdkSettings(const SdkSettings &)=delete (defined in gem::SdkSettings) | gem::SdkSettings | |
| SdkSettings(SdkSettings &&)=default | gem::SdkSettings | |
| setAllowConnection(bool allow, OffboardListener listener) noexcept | gem::SdkSettings | inline |
| setAllowOffboardServiceOnExtraChargedNetwork(EServiceGroupType serviceType, bool allow) noexcept | gem::SdkSettings | inline |
| setAppAuthorization(const String &token) noexcept | gem::SdkSettings | inline |
| setApplicationName(const String &name) noexcept | gem::SdkSettings | inline |
| setApplicationVersion(int version, int subVersion, int revision) noexcept | gem::SdkSettings | inline |
| setDecimalSeparator(char16_t sep) noexcept | gem::SdkSettings | inline |
| setDeviceModel(const String &deviceModel) noexcept | gem::SdkSettings | inline |
| setDeviceName(const String &deviceName) noexcept | gem::SdkSettings | inline |
| setDigitGroupSeparator(char16_t sep) noexcept | gem::SdkSettings | inline |
| setLanguage(const Language &language) noexcept | gem::SdkSettings | inline |
| setLanguage(const String &languageCode, const String ®ionCode=String(), const String &scriptCode=String(), int variant=0) noexcept | gem::SdkSettings | inline |
| setLanguageByName(const String &languageName) noexcept | gem::SdkSettings | inline |
| setMapLanguage(EMapLanguage mapLanguage) noexcept | gem::SdkSettings | inline |
| setNetworkProvider(NetworkProvider networkProvider) noexcept | gem::SdkSettings | inline |
| setTheme(ETheme sel) noexcept | gem::SdkSettings | inline |
| setTilesMaxSpace(int maxSpace) noexcept | gem::SdkSettings | inline |
| setUnitSystem(EUnitSystem unitSystem) noexcept | gem::SdkSettings | inline |
| setVoice(const Voice &voice, const Language &lang=Language()) noexcept | gem::SdkSettings | inline |
| setVoiceByPath(const String &filePath, const Language &lang=Language()) noexcept | gem::SdkSettings | inline |
| verifyAppAuthorization(const String &token, ProgressListener listener) const noexcept | gem::SdkSettings | inline |